Understanding Cyber Attack Defense Training

Cyber attack defense training is a specialized education program designed to equip employees and management with knowledge and skills to identify, prevent, and respond to cyber threats. As hackers evolve in sophistication, so must your team’s ability to defend against these threats. The training covers various aspects, including:

  • Identifying Phishing Attempts: Employees learn to recognize the signs of phishing that can lead to data breaches.
  • Understanding Malware: This includes education on various types of malware and how to prevent infection.
  • Implementing Best Practices: Training includes guidelines for strong password creation and management, secure browsing habits, and safe sharing of information.
  • Incident Response Protocols: Employees are trained on how to respond effectively if a cyber incident occurs.

Components of Effective Cyber Attack Defense Training

For cyber attack defense training to be effective, it should encompass various components, ensuring comprehensive knowledge transfer. Here are key elements to include:

1. Risk Assessment and Management

Training should include methods for assessing risks that your business faces. Employees must learn to evaluate potential vulnerabilities in the organization’s IT infrastructure and how to prioritize security measures effectively.

2. Hands-On Training and Simulations

Theoretical knowledge is essential; however, practical application is equally important. Hands-on training sessions, including simulations of cyber-attack scenarios, allow employees to practice their response strategies and gain confidence in their abilities.

3. Regular Updates and Continuous Learning

The landscape of cyber threats is constantly changing. Regular updates and refresher courses ensure that employees are aware of the latest threats and defense strategies. Continuous learning is crucial in maintaining a strong defense.

4. Collaboration and Communication

Effective cybersecurity involves collaboration across departments. Training should promote team communication regarding security issues and encourage reporting of potential threats without fear of retribution.

Measuring the Effectiveness of Cyber Attack Defense Training

After investing time and resources into creating a cyber attack defense training program, it is crucial to measure its effectiveness. Here are some methods to assess training outcomes:

  • Feedback Surveys: Collect feedback from employees regarding the training content, delivery methods, and overall experience.
  • Knowledge Assessments: Conduct quizzes or tests to evaluate what employees have learned and identify knowledge gaps.
  • Simulated Attacks: Run simulated cyber-attack scenarios to see how well employees respond and adhere to protocols.
  • Monitoring Incident Reports: Review the number and severity of security incidents before and after the training to gauge improvement.
